Marine sector clients require a specialist service that is geared to dealing with the international nature of shipping and can handle claims that need to be pursued both within the UK and overseas. You need a service that can act promptly to deal with assets within the jurisdiction (including ship arrest, caveats, restraining injunctions, use of liens etc). You need a service that has access to specialist legal support throughout the world.

We have substantial experience of dealing with shipping contracts and recognise the issues arising from many of these contracts, especially some of the provisions that may give additional recovery opportunities such as:

  • identification of the range of parties who might be liable for the debt (including agents responsible party clauses etc)
  • exercise of lien clauses
  • arrest of ships, bunkers etc
  • injunctions
  • Rule B applications in New York (i.e. seizure of US$ going through the banking system in New York which is currently seen as the major weapon for overseas debt recovery

Through our considerable experience of handling marine cases throughout the world, we have built up knowledge of the special characteristics of different jurisdictions. This can be important when deciding what is the best jurisdiction to arrest a vessel. For example:

  • There are some jurisdictions better than others for lifting the veil of incorporation.
  • Some jurisdictions allow arrest of bunkers.
  • Some jurisdictions have a quick and cheap arrest process whereas others are expensive and time consuming.
